An infrared eccentric photo-optometer.

A Roorda1, W R Bobier, M C Campbell.   

Abstract

An objective infrared optometer has been designed, based on the optical principles of eccentric photorefraction. A CCD camera with an eccentric infrared light source images the subject's pupil through a Badal optometer. The slope of the light distribution across the pupil is continuously recorded. Accommodative state is measured by moving the camera behind the Badal lens until the slope is zero. This position corresponds to the case where the camera is conjugate with the retina of the observer. In this Badal optometer, the irradiance of light at the pupil plane, the sensitivity of the photorefractor, and the focal setting of the camera lens remain constant for all positions of the camera from the eye. The repeatability of a single measure of refractive state in a cyclopleged eye was less than 0.05 D. Static accommodative responses taken from 3 subjects in both closed and open loop conditions provided expected stimulus/response measures. The instrument can also be adapted to measure dynamic accommodation.
